Early Voting Breaks Record

Now that early voting has come and gone in our state it appears more people took advantage of it than ever before. State election officials say our state set records for early voting this year. When early voting ended Saturday, state officials
expected up to 1,000,000 people to have voted. That could equal 18 percent of all registered voters. Four years ago, 56 percent of registered voters cast ballots in the Bush-Gore presidential election. 350,000 people voted early.
